Requirements and responsibilities


We are seeking an experienced Implementation and Support Engineer specializing in Enterprise Security to handle network implementation, configuration, support, and design. The ideal candidate will bring strong expertise in routing, switching, wireless networks, and security best practices, ensuring the robust performance of complex network infrastructures. This is a Full-Time Contractor Job / Remote from LATAM / C1 English Level is Required. Required Education and Experience: - Bachelor's degree in Telecommunications Engineering, Electronics Engineering, or a related field with at least 4 years of experience in network implementation, configuration, support, and design using routing and switching technologies, as well as general security best practices. - Experience with Cisco, Fortinet, HP, and Aruba equipment (Firewalls, Routing / Switching, Wireless, and Security). - Experience working for large financial organizations, service providers, and enterprises with cloud environments is highly preferred. Technical Knowledge: General Knowledge: - Administration and configuration of wired and wireless infrastructures. - Advanced knowledge of Routing, Switching, Wireless, and Security. - Project lifecycles. - Documentation of implementation and test plans. - Management and execution of maintenance changes. - Customer support. Advanced Routing Knowledge (Implementation, configuration, and support): - IP Addressing. - Static routes. - Routing protocols: BGP, EIGRP, OSPF. - DHCP, DNS, VRF, MPLS, Load Balancing. Advanced Switching Knowledge (Implementation, configuration, and support): - VLAN, Nexus vPC, VSS, OTV. - Spanning-tree. - Port-channels. Wireless Knowledge (Implementation, configuration, and support – Cisco, Aruba): - Knowledge of Wireless RF principles. - Knowledge of Wireless network design and implementation. - Knowledge and experience executing all types of Site Surveys. - WLC and AP management, different deployment modes, and solutions. Advanced Security Knowledge: - NAT, ACL. - IPSEC / SSLVPN, DMVPN. - IPS/IDS, and other NGFW (Next-Generation Firewall) features and capabilities. - Experience with Cisco Firepower Services and Palo Alto security services. - Experience with Fortinet security equipment. Desirable Certifications: - Implementing and Administering Cisco Solutions (CCNA). - 350-401 ENCOR Implementing and Operating Cisco Enterprise Network Core Technologies (ENCOR). - 300-410 ENARSI Implementing Cisco Enterprise Advanced Routing and Services (ENARSI). - 350-701 SCOR Implementing and Operating Cisco Security Core Technologies (SCOR). - 300-710 SNCF Securing Networks with Cisco Firepower Next Generation Firewall (SSNGFW) / Securing Networks with Cisco Firepower Next-Generation IPS (SSFIPS). - 300-730 SVPN Implementing Secure Solutions with Virtual Private Networks (SVPN). - Implementing Cisco Enterprise Wireless Networks – ENWLSI 300-430. - Fortinet NSE 4 - FortiOS (FortiGate Security and FortiGate Infrastructure). Skills: - Adaptability. - Time management. - Self-directed learner. - Teamwork. - Organization of activities and processes. - Ability to work based on objectives and strict delivery deadlines. - Communicative / Excellent verbal expression. - Basic understanding of project management. - Ability to work well under pressure. - Ability to identify and propose improvements for any of the previously listed technologies. - Analytical, planning, organizational, and control skills. Job Responsibilities: - Perform network and security assessments, including gap analysis using information gathering tools. Create relevant documentation for client engagements, such as diagrams, detailed assessments, and design documents. - Provide technical analysis of existing or legacy technology in an environment, present modernized network and security solutions, and define features and capabilities according to customer requirements. - Assist Solution Architects in identifying and defining the scope of work and technical assumptions for statements of work (SOWs). - Ability to independently complete large and complex projects. - Stay updated on emerging technologies and products, including obtaining certifications and participating in industry events as appropriate. - Work with various stakeholders to lead troubleshooting efforts, develop system roadmaps, and make critical decisions. - Provide clear communication with regular updates/reports to project and account teams.
